LISBON (AFP) —Theo Bos (Blanco) seized the lead of the Volta ao Algarve (Tour of Algarve) after winning Friday’s second stage.

The 195km leg started and finished in Lagoa, in southern Portugal.

Friday’s stage saw an early break of 10 dwindle to six before the peloton shut it down 5km from the finish. Bos then out-sprinted Giacomo Nizzolo and Bruno Sancho to take the stage win and the leader’s yellow jersey.

Saturday’s third stage will take the peloton over 193km from Portimao to Viola Malhoa.
